The Satyanarayan Pooja ritual is described in the Skanda and Bhavishya Puranas as focusing on the principles of bhakti (devotion), karma (duty), dharma (righteousness) and moksha (liberation). It involves prayers, offerings, storytelling and aims to popularize spiritual concepts through allegorical tales emphasizing moral values.
